“We’ve vaccinated more people than all those infected since the outbreak of the pandemic,” says Israeli Health Minister Yuli Edelstein. A Clalit HMO COVID-19 vaccination center in Jerusalem, on Dec. 28, 2020. Photo by Yonatan Sindel/Flash90. (December 29, 2020 / Israel Hayom) As Israel’s COVID-19 infection rate on Tuesday approached that recorded in October at the height of the pandemic’s “second wave,” Israeli...
